Whether it’s seen as a sacrifice or not is up to the person that did the work to give it up. Right? Sacrifice means to surrender something for the sake of something else. Sacrifice can have a heavy, painful, connotation to it especially if you’re thinking of it from a Biblical sense. The word sacrifice can also simply mean to give something up for the sake of something else.For our chat today, I’ll refer to “letting go of” and “giving something up” as meaning the same as sacrifice. Is it Easy or Difficult for High Achieving Women in Direct Sales to Let Go? I see this letting go or giving something up on a continuum of easy to difficult. On one end, the difficult end, it’s seen as a sacrifice. A difficult and painful choice that can resurface and keep coming up. It’s really hard. On the other end of the continuum, it just happens organically. It’s not even a choice to let go of something. It’s just what happens when you’re having fun and motivated to keep going, spending time on what’s fun about your business. Other things that take your time and energy fall off and surprise, they weren’t that important to you or they would have stuck around. Everything in between easy and difficult is still a choice or a decision. It simply has to be done in order to create space, time, mental energy, and focus. Something has to give. Top Leaders in Direct Sales Make These Types of SacrificesHere’s what other high-achieving women in direct sales have shared with me that they have given up. Some women have let go of friendships or relationships that didn’t honor or support their personal dreams and goals for their business. Some have given up alcohol. They weren’t big drinkers to begin with, but they stopped the wine. No judgment here. Right. It just wasn’t serving them any longer. They made different choices for themselves. Some gave up the tidiness and cleanliness of their home. Adopting an “It can wait” mentality was what they chose in order to spend that time working. Some gave up t.v. They share, it just kind of hit me, why would I watch others' reality or journey to success when I could be actively working on my own. Again, no judgment. It was simply a realization others have made for themselves. I can relate to this one though. T.V. was something I watched while folding laundry, or doing busy work around the house.
